Castro with the lob … Judge with the finish! American LeagueAmerican League EastBaseballEastFFF;Major League BaseballMLBMLB American LeagueMLB American League EastMLB EastNew YorkNew York CityNew York YankeesNewYorkYankeesYankeeYankee StadiumYankees